Matthew 5:9 Interlinear

Blessed are the peacemakers for they the children of God shall be called

Word-by-Word Analysis

#OriginalStrong'sEnglishDefinition
1ΜακάριοιG3107Blessedsupremely blest; by extension, fortunate, well off
2οἱG3588the (sometimes to be supplied, at others omitted, in english idiom)
3εἰρηνοποιοί·G1518are the peacemakerspacificatory, i.e., (subjectively) peaceable
4ὅτιG3754fordemonstrative, that (sometimes redundant); causative, because
5αὐτοὶG846theythe reflexive pronoun self, used (alone or in the comparative g1438) of the third person, and (with the proper personal pronoun) of the other persons
6υἱοὶG5207the childrena "son" (sometimes of animals), used very widely of immediate, remote or figuratively, kinship
7θεοῦG2316of Goda deity, especially (with g3588) the supreme divinity; figuratively, a magistrate; exceedingly (by hebraism)
8κληθήσονταιG2564shall be calledto "call" (properly, aloud, but used in a variety of applications, directly or otherwise)
